About 10 years ago, American Express had a service where you could create one-time credit card numbers for using it online. I loved it.

For whatever reason, a couple of years later, they got rid of the service. It's times like these when a service like that would have been perfect.



So, Citi provides a similar "Virtual Account Number" service which allows a cardholder to create a new cc# with a new expiration date and a specific balance, but the billing address cannot be customized which reduces the usefulness of the service.

As far as I know, it's also free.
